We are hiring a Staff Software Engineer for our Frontier Security AI team. Snowflake's Frontier Security AI teams develop production-grade LLM applications, intelligent agents, AI infrastructure, and evaluation systems for enterprise customers - products that must meet a high bar for quality, security, reliability, and efficiency while operating over sensitive data at large scale. In this role, you will lead the design and development of our Agentic Harness and agent evaluation platform, working across product, infrastructure, applied AI, security, and modeling teams to take new capabilities from prototype to dependable customer value. AS A STAFF SOFTWARE ENGINEER AT SNOWFLAKE, YOU WILL: - Architect and build the Agentic Harness that executes complex, multi-step AI workflows across models, tools, data, and services. - Design stable interfaces for tool execution, context construction, state management, memory, permissions, retries, fallbacks, and human review. - Own agent quality end to end by building evaluation harnesses, representative datasets, automated graders, experiment pipelines, and release gates. - Convert ambiguous reports such as "the agent feels worse" into measurable failure modes, reproducible tests, and durable fixes. - Analyze production agent trajectories to identify failures in reasoning, retrieval, tool use, context, orchestration, and application code. - Close the loop between production incidents, root-cause analysis, evaluation coverage, and regression prevention. - Develop offline and online measurements for task completion, correctness, groundedness, safety, latency, reliability, and cost. - Build simulation and replay infrastructure for golden-set tests, adversarial scenarios, model comparisons, and large-scale experiments. - Improve agent efficiency through model routing, prompt and semantic caching, context compaction, tool-result management, and token optimization. - Productionize new model capabilities as secure, observable, multi-tenant services with clear operational controls. - Establish standards for evaluation design, including sampling, ground-truth quality, grader calibration, leakage prevention, and statistical significance. - Define technical direction across multiple teams and lead projects whose scope extends beyond a single service. - Mentor engineers, raise the quality of architecture reviews, and remain directly involved in implementation and debugging. OUR IDEAL STAFF SOFTWARE ENGINEER WILL HAVE: - 9+ years of software engineering experience, including technical leadership of complex production systems. - Direct experience shipping and operating LLM applications, AI agents, or model-backed workflows in production. - Strong background in distributed systems, service architecture, high-throughput APIs, concurrency, and failure handling. - Experience building an agent runtime, workflow engine, developer platform, evaluation system, or similar infrastructure. - Demonstrated ability to evaluate nondeterministic systems without relying on a single aggregate score. - Fluency in Python and strong proficiency in at least one systems or application language such as Java, Go, Rust, or TypeScript. - Hands-on knowledge of tool calling, structured generation, retrieval, context engineering, prompt management, and model APIs. - Experience with production observability, including structured traces, replay, metrics, logs, and incident diagnosis. - Ability to balance agent quality with latency, reliability, security, and inference cost. - Track record of setting technical direction and delivering results across organizational boundaries. - Bachelor's degree in Computer Science, Engineering, or a related field, or equivalent practical experience. - Clear written and verbal communication with engineering, product, and leadership audiences. BONUS POINTS FOR THE FOLLOWING: - Building evaluation or observability infrastructure for agentic coding, data engineering, or analytics systems. - Designing human-evaluation programs, scoring rubrics, annotation workflows, or grader-calibration methods. - Working with multi-agent orchestration, long-running agents, asynchronous workflows, or durable execution. - Developing synthetic tasks, simulations, adversarial tests, red-team exercises, or safety guardrails. - Building retrieval systems that use vector search, hybrid search, semantic indexing, ranking, or caching. - Operating multi-tenant systems that process sensitive enterprise data. - Working with model training, fine-tuning, reinforcement learning, or feedback-driven optimization. - Evaluating and onboarding frontier models based on measured product outcomes. - Experience with databases, SQL engines, data platforms, Kubernetes, or cloud-native infrastructure. YOU MAY BE A PARTICULARLY GOOD FIT IF YOU: - Treat evaluation as part of product engineering rather than a final validation step. - Can move between agent behavior, distributed infrastructure, data analysis, and production debugging. - Question metrics that do not reconcile and design tests that can expose misleading results. - Take ownership from early architecture through deployment, operations, and measurable customer outcomes. - Prefer evidence from representative tasks and production behavior over isolated benchmark results. - Work effectively in fast-moving environments where requirements develop through experimentation. About Snowflake Computing

Snowflake is a cloud-based data-warehousing company that was founded in 2012. The company provides a data platform that allows customers to store and analyze data using cloud-based infrastructure. Snowflake's platform is designed to be highly scalable and flexible, allowing customers to easily add or remove computing resources as needed. The company's customers include a wide range of businesses, from startups to Fortune 500 companies. Snowflake has received significant funding from investors and has been recognized as one of the fastest-growing companies in the United States.
